CS 2253 - Computer Networking |
Three credit hour lecture course. This course is designed to provide the student with basic information and understanding about networking technologies including descriptions, specific terminology, the OSI model for networked communications, components of networks, analysis and design of computer networking systems, including security and management of networks. For each unit of credit, a minimum of three hours per week with one of the hours for class and two hours for studying/preparation outside of class is expected.
